Transaction 62b695436ca3c689a6b767b83bf93843d3ebbf720b66223170e534fc017fdbe0
1 Input
2 Outputs
- 62b695436ca3c689a6b767b83bf93843d3ebbf720b66223170e534fc017fdbe0:0
- 62b695436ca3c689a6b767b83bf93843d3ebbf720b66223170e534fc017fdbe0:1
value 1317000
address 1DVLyUB8k5iH5NzxCqTZmDDaaa4KUsfPSR
value 13104863
address 1H9AANfaGevCsiTVydb1AXjuFdrvVVqe2J